Firewall Gateway · 5 min read · Oct 20, 2025

Imposta Ubuntu-Server 6.10 come Firewall/Gateway per il tuo Ambiente di Piccole Imprese - Pagina 3

Quindi ora abbiamo bisogno di alcuni pacchetti. Fai (tutto in una riga!):

apt-get install postfix postfix-doc courier-authlib-mysql courier-pop courier-pop-ssl courier-imap courier-imap-ssl libsasl2-modules-sql sasl2-bin libpam-mysql build-essential dpkg-dev fakeroot debhelper libdb4.2-dev libgdbm-dev libldap2-dev libpcre3-dev libmysqlclient15-dev libssl-dev libsasl2-dev postgresql-dev po-debconf dpatch zoo unzip arj rdate fetchmail unzip zip ncftp libarchive-zip-perl zlib1g-dev libpopt-dev nmap lynx fileutils curl mail-audit-tools libwww-perl imagemagick squirrelmail squirrelmail-locales munin munin-node ntp samba spamassassin razor pyzor unzoo spamc libio-string-perl libnet-ident-perl libio-socket-ssl-perl libapache2-mod-php4 libapache2-mod-perl2 php4 php4-cli php4-common php4-curl php4-dev php4-domxml php4-gd php4-imap php4-ldap php4-mcal php4-mhash php4-mysql php4-odbc php4-pear php4-xslt curl libwww-perl php-pear mailscanner mailx libzzip-dev libgmp3c2 libgmp3-dev dhcp3-server pptpd

Accetta tutte le impostazioni predefinite.

Ora fai:

mysqladmin -u root password yourrootsqlpassword ##USARE UNA PASSWORD REALE QUI!

Ora configura Apache e Squirrelmail.

/usr/sbin/squirrelmail-configure

Impostalo su courier (opzione D) e fallo come preferisci. Non dimenticare di abilitare alcuni plugin e di impostare una lingua predefinita se desiderato. Inoltre, ti consiglio di impostare questo:

$show_contain_subfolders_option = true;

Il mio /etc/squirrelmail/config.php ora appare così:
(Solo la mia configurazione attuale. Non copiare questo, usalo come riferimento.)

Successivamente fai:

apache2-ssl-certificate -days 3650

Compila il nome del server corretto!!!

Cioè: l’indirizzo su cui intendi dare ai tuoi utenti accesso a Squirrelmail o a qualsiasi altro servizio tramite apache sulla porta 443. (useremo anche questo per postfix, imaps e pop3s) Solo il dominio andrà bene (DEVE ESISTERE IN DNS). Non dominio/webmail

Se qualcosa è andato storto, basta eliminare il certificato e ripetere questo passaggio.

Ora inserisci:

a2enmod ssl
a2enmod rewrite
a2enmod include
cp /etc/apache2/sites-available/default /etc/apache2/sites-available/https
ln -s /etc/apache2/sites-available/https /etc/apache2/sites-enabled/https
ln -s /etc/squirrelmail/apache.conf /etc/apache2/sites-enabled/squirrelmail
Share: X/Twitter LinkedIn

Ricevi i nuovi post nella tua casella di posta.

Nessuno spam. Disiscriviti in qualsiasi momento.